Engineering Compromises and Strategic Trade-offs
The Pixel 10a’s specifications reveal a carefully calibrated balance between cost management and feature preservation. While Google has not released complete technical specifications, industry sources suggest the device will incorporate many of the computational photography capabilities that have become synonymous with the Pixel brand. This approach mirrors the company’s historical strategy of leveraging software optimization to compensate for hardware limitations, a methodology that has proven particularly effective in the camera department.
The device is expected to feature Google’s Tensor G4 processor, albeit potentially in a binned or slightly underclocked variant to manage thermal performance and cost. This represents a significant advantage over competitors who must rely on Qualcomm’s Snapdragon offerings, where the price differential between flagship and mid-range chips can substantially impact bill-of-materials costs. By controlling its own silicon, Google maintains greater flexibility in how it positions the Pixel 10a against both premium and budget alternatives.
Display technology represents another area where Google must walk a fine line. While flagship devices increasingly feature LTPO OLED panels with adaptive refresh rates reaching 120Hz, the Pixel 10a will likely employ a more conventional OLED screen, possibly with a fixed 90Hz refresh rate. This compromise allows Google to maintain visual fluidity without incurring the cost premium associated with more advanced display technology. The decision reflects broader industry trends, where manufacturers must identify which features genuinely influence purchase decisions versus those that serve primarily as specification sheet fodder.

Pricing strategy will prove crucial to the device’s success. Previous A-series devices have typically launched at price points between $449 and $499, positioning them as premium mid-range offerings rather than true budget devices. This positioning has limited their appeal in price-sensitive markets while failing to capture consumers willing to stretch their budgets for flagship experiences. Google must carefully consider whether to maintain this pricing structure or adopt a more aggressive approach that could expand its addressable market but potentially cannibalize Pixel 10 sales.

Component sourcing represents another critical consideration. The global semiconductor shortage that plagued the industry from 2020 through 2023 has largely abated, but supply chain volatility remains a concern. Google’s decision to design its own processors provides some insulation from Qualcomm’s supply constraints, though the company remains dependent on TSMC for chip fabrication. This relationship, while generally stable, carries geopolitical risks given Taiwan’s strategic importance and ongoing tensions with China.
The device’s bill of materials likely reflects careful optimization to maintain acceptable margins while hitting target price points. Industry analysts estimate that mid-range smartphones typically carry gross margins between 20-30%, significantly lower than the 40-50% margins on flagship devices. Google must therefore achieve substantial scale to justify the Pixel 10a’s development and marketing costs, making the device’s commercial success critical to the program’s continuation.
